Transaction 731093eefee1365401a407b612cd092a5172a8d0d27566132d86d22deba517f5
1 Input
1 Output
-
731093eefee1365401a407b612cd092a5172a8d0d27566132d86d22deba517f5:0
- value
- 308000
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 ee341b4b5a8bfabeaab4c64fa35a2017e2a18e1f066c1e484ba73dcad6c5c99f
- address
- bc1pac6pkj6630ata245ce86xk3qzl32rrslqekpujzt5u7u44k9ex0svgnuwl